TUITION REIMBURSEMENT FOR NEW/RECENT GRADS Summary: Responsible for
the planning, provision, and coordination of all aspects of direct
patient care in accordance with established clinic and departmental
policies and procedures, maintaining the highest degree of quality
care in a safe environment. The therapist works collaboratively
with other patient team personnel in maintaining standards of
professional physical therapy practice.The staff therapist, using
independent judgment, assumes responsibility and accountability for
the delivery of physical therapy services provided by Physical
Therapist Assistants and Rehab Techs/Aides. May be assigned to
orient staff and students and assume the duties and
responsibilities of the Clinic Director in the absence of that
individual. Essential Duties and Responsibilities: Provides high
quality patient care and assessment in accordance with established
practice standards and clinic/departmental policies in a safe
environment. Performs patient evaluation, summarizes objective
clinical findings, and develops an accurate individualized plan of
care. Ensures that goals are feasible, based upon findings and
patient expectations. Provides treatment in accordance with
physician's orders and established plan of care. Evaluates
effectiveness of treatment plan and revises plan of care as
indicated. Communicates/collaborates with patient, family,
caregivers, significant other and other members of the healthcare
team to promote maximum benefit of care. Communicates/collaborates
with the patient's referral source such as the physician, NCM, ADJ,
etc. regarding the patient's care and progress to promote maximum
benefit of care. Assess educational needs of the patient, family,
caregiver, or significant other and other members of healthcare
team to promote maximum benefit of care. Demonstrates appropriate
knowledge and correct application of clinical techniques,
procedures and programs for clinical setting and patient/client
populations served. Plans and makes appropriate discharge plans.
Assesses the risks for safety and implements appropriate
precautions. Complies with appropriate and approved security and
safety standards. Utilizes appropriate leadership skills in
delegating, organizing, and educating coworkers and staff.
Participates in and contributes to quality improvement process.
Makes effective use of patient schedule and time by achieving
various efficiency standards such as skilled units per visit,
visits per day, and evaluations plus two-skilled units. Completes
timely, competent, and compliant documentation using AgileRPM.
Travels to other local clinics as assigned. This list of duties is
not intended to be all-inclusive and may be expanded to include
other duties or responsibilities that senior management may deem
necessary. Qualifications: Master's or Doctorate degree in Physical
Therapy. Current Physical Therapist license, registration and/or
certification as per state regulations. Physical Demands: The
physical demands described here are representative of those that
must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ential
funct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to
en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ential
functions. The employee is frequently required to stand; walk; sit;
reach with hands and arms; climb or balance and stoop, kneel,
crouch, or crawl. The employee must regularly lift and /or move up
to 25 pounds and occasionally lift and/or move more than 100
